WebMar 28, 2024 · Which foods contain vitamin B12? Vitamin B12 is mainly found in meat, offal, milk, fish and eggs. The richest sources are liver, clams, kidney and oysters. Liver is also incredibly high in other B vitamins such as riboflavin, vitamin B12, niacin, … cd gustavo lima 2019WebFor injections of vitamin B12 given in the UK, hydroxocobalamin is preferred to an alternative called cyanocobalamin. This is because hydroxocobalamin stays in the body for longer. Treating folate deficiency anaemia.
